Users worldwide experienced issues connecting to Facebook, Instagram and Tinder, both on the Web and via mobile apps this morning.

It is unclear what caused the outage which first occurred around 1:10am ET. However, the Facebook-owned mobile messaging service, WhatsApp, was working fine as usual.

The outage lasted for at least one hour before they were both restored.

The last time Facebook experienced this sort of issue was last year September, when the social network went down twice that month. The most recent one before today's outage lasted 15 minutes.
